Craftsmanship and Artistry


The artistry involved in creating a wood and glass showcase is something to behold. Master carpenters and skilled glassworkers collaborate to create pieces that not only serve their purpose but also tell a story. The choice of wood, whether it be rich mahogany, elegant oak, or rustic pine, determines the character of the showcase. Each type of wood has its own unique grain and hue, which can complement or contrast with the transparent elegance of glass.


Glass, on the other hand, comes in various forms—clear, frosted, colored, and even textured. The type of glass chosen can significantly affect the visual appeal of the showcase. Clear glass offers transparency, allowing unobstructed views of the items on display, while frosted or colored glass can add an element of intrigue or soften the overall appearance. The delicate interplay between wood and glass creates an inviting atmosphere that showcases the items displayed within.


Practical Functionality


While the aesthetic appeal of wood and glass showcases is undeniable, their practical functionality cannot be overlooked

. These showcases are designed to protect and highlight valuable items, making them perfect for displaying everything from family heirlooms to modern art pieces. The enclosure helps to keep dust and debris at bay, while also shielding delicate objects from accidental damage.

In spaces like galleries and museums, the careful design of these showcases acts as an effective barrier, allowing viewers to appreciate artwork without direct contact. Many showcases are equipped with lighting features that enhance visibility, casting soft illumination on the displayed items and further drawing the eye. Adjustable shelves and glass doors facilitate easy access, showcasing the thoughtful design considerations that blend function with form.


Versatile Applications


Wood and glass showcases are incredibly versatile and can fit seamlessly into various settings. In residential spaces, they can serve as elegant furniture pieces in living rooms, dining areas, or offices. A well-placed showcase can become a focal point of a room, sparking conversations and showcasing personal taste. Whether housing an antique collection or serving as a contemporary display for books and art, these pieces adapt to different aesthetics, from rustic farmhouse to sleek modernism.


Commercially, these showcases serve a critical role in retail environments. Jewelry stores, boutiques, and galleries utilize wood and glass displays to highlight their products. The transparent nature of glass allows potential buyers to admire items without feeling the barrier of a traditional countertop. The inviting interplay of wood warmth and glass clarity encourages interaction, ultimately enhancing the shopping experience.
